Stuff is a renowned American music group formed in the early 1970s, consisting of some of the most talented session musicians of the time. The band was founded by Steve Gadd, Richard Tee, Eric Gale, Gordon Edwards, and Cornell Dupree, all of whom were highly sought-after studio musicians in New York City. Stuff quickly gained a reputation for their tight grooves, impeccable musicianship, and ability to effortlessly blend various genres such as jazz, funk, and R&B. Their self-titled debut album, released in 1976, was a critical and commercial success, showcasing their unique sound and virtuosic playing. Throughout the 1970s and 1980s, Stuff released several more albums and toured extensively, solidifying their status as one of the premier instrumental bands of the era.
